Depends on your thinning but yes generally the shorter the better with thinning. I would say strt with like a 5 on top or so as its kind of a buzz but sill a little length- if your face fits it well you can go shorter. I just go to a barber shop and say like a 5 and a 2 and see how it looks- then they can take it down more if you want

Depends where you are thinning or receding, but a good hairstyle for those who are receding at the temples would be like a german youth cut or an undercut type style. I'm receding at my temples and I get a 1.5 length on the sides and back of my head, while I keep the top longer to spike or comb over.

Yeah, you might want to go full buzz down to a number one in this scenario. Unless you can find a good barber that can go really short in the back and fade it up to the crown area so it makes your crown thinning not visible. This way you can keep your hair slightly longer on top so as to have some hair in the front to style over the balding patches.
